读取SBT项目resources目录中的文件
生活随笔
收集整理的這篇文章主要介紹了
读取SBT项目resources目录中的文件
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
本文簡述在SBT構建的項目中讀取resources目錄中的資源文件。
在SBT構建的項目中, src/main 和 src/test 目錄下都有一個名為 resources 的目錄,用來存放相應的資源文件。那么如何來讀取相應 resources 目錄中的資源文件呢?
現假設有 test.data 文件,存放在 main/resources/data/test.data 中,文件內容為:
test data1 test data2 test data3使用如下代碼讀取文件并將文件內容輸出:
scaladef main(args: Array[String]) {val lines = Source.fromURL(getClass.getResource("/data/test.data")).getLines()lines.foreach(println) }類似的,在 src/test 中 resources 目錄下的資源文件也可以這么讀取。
總結
以上是生活随笔為你收集整理的读取SBT项目resources目录中的文件的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: Linux中设置定期备份oracle数据
- 下一篇: OpenStack监控测量服务Ceilo